Re: ac compressor relay location
2 other things that can stop the compressor from engaging:
- low pressure cut-out switch
- full-throttle cut-out switch
If either of these switches are defective (or actively doing their jobs) the compressor will not engage (my low-pressure cut-out switch needed to be replaced)
